Basic Information
CAS No.: 20228-27-7
Name: Ruvazone
Molecular Structure:
Molecular Structure of 20228-27-7 (Ruvazone)
Formula: C12H14 N2 O4
Molecular Weight: 250.254
Synonyms: Benzoicacid, 2-ethoxy-, (1-carboxyethylidene)hydrazide (9CI); Benzoic acid, o-ethoxy-,(1-carboxyethylidene)hydrazide (8CI); M 6/42; M 6/42 (pharmaceutical); Pyruvicacid o-ethoxybenzoylhydrazone; Ruvazone
Density: 1.23g/cm3
Melting Point: 185°C
Boiling Point: °Cat760mmHg
Flash Point: °C
Safety: Poison by ingestion, subcutaneous, intramuscular, and intraperitoneal routes. When heated to decomposition it emits toxic fumes of NOx.
PSA: 91.48000
LogP: 1.85040

Chemistry

 Ruvazone with CAS register number of 20228-27-7 has some synonyms as 2-Ethoxybenzoic acid 2-(1-carboxyethylidene) hydrazide ; Etossidrazone ; M6/42 ; M6-42 ; Ruvazon [INN-Spanish] ; Ruvazonum [INN-Latin] ; Pyruvic acid, O-ethoxybenzoylhydrazone ; BRN 2591488 ; o-Ethoxy-benzoyl-hydrazone of pyruvic acid ; CID9570360 ,and so on.
IUPAC Name: (2E)-2-[(2-ethoxybenzoyl)hydrazinylidene]propanoic acid
CAS: 20228-27-7
Molecular Formula: C12H14N2O4
Molecular Weight: 250.2506
Molecular structure:
ACD/LogD (pH 5.5):  -3 
ACD/LogD (pH 7.4):  -3 
ACD/BCF (pH 5.5):  1 
ACD/BCF (pH 7.4):  1 
ACD/KOC (pH 5.5):  1 
ACD/KOC (pH 7.4):  1 
H bond acceptors:  6 
H bond donors:  2 
Freely Rotating Bonds:  5 
Index of Refraction:  1.552 
Molar Refractivity:  64.982 cm3 
Molar Volume:  203.35 cm3 
Polarizability:  25.761×10-24cm3 
Surface Tension:  43.933 dyne/cm 
Density:  1.231 g/cm3

Toxicity Data With Reference

1.    

orl-rat LD50:507 mg/kg

    BCFAAI    Bollettino Chimico Farmaceutico. 107 (1968),769.
2.    

ipr-rat LD50:157 mg/kg

    BCFAAI    Bollettino Chimico Farmaceutico. 107 (1968),769.
3.    

scu-rat LD50:600 mg/kg

    BCFAAI    Bollettino Chimico Farmaceutico. 107 (1968),769.
4.    

ims-rat LD50:206 mg/kg

    BCFAAI    Bollettino Chimico Farmaceutico. 107 (1968),769.
5.    

orl-mus LD50:324 mg/kg

    BCFAAI    Bollettino Chimico Farmaceutico. 107 (1968),769.
6.    

ipr-mus LD50:166 mg/kg

    BCFAAI    Bollettino Chimico Farmaceutico. 107 (1968),769.
7.    

scu-mus LD50:207 mg/kg

    BCFAAI    Bollettino Chimico Farmaceutico. 107 (1968),769.
8.    

ims-mus LD50:185 mg/kg

    BCFAAI    Bollettino Chimico Farmaceutico. 107 (1968),769.

Safety Profile

 Ruvazone (CAS No.20228-27-7) is poisonous by ingestion, subcutaneous, intramuscular, and intraperitoneal routes. When heated to decomposition it emits toxic fumes of NOx.
